First Refresher Training on Emergency Assessment for CHF-EAT and in-country ASEAN ERAT Team

The training is co-organized by the National Committee for Disaster Management (NCDM) and Cambodia Humanitarian Forum (CHF).The event was organized to build and strengthen the humanitarian actors’ capacity for the emergency assessment team (EAT) and in-country emergency regional assessment team (ERAT) on the data collection in terms of damage and needs of affected people. There are approximately planned 26 participants including CHF members (EAT members), the Federation of Association of Smal and Medium Enterprises of Cambodia (FASMEC), and NCDM/PCDM staff. The training is supported by the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ation (the foundation) and the United States Agency for International Development Bureau of Humanitarian Assistance (USAID BHA) with coordination supports from the Preparedness Partnership of Cambodia (PPC) Secretariat. 

The objectives of the session include:

·  To share experience and learning between ERAT and EAT team in data collection by using HRF assessment tools 

·  To strengthen the network between ERAT and EAT team 

·  To share good experience and challenges on flood assessment in 2020
